{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,11,18]],"date-time":"2025-11-18T09:20:34Z","timestamp":1763457634296,"version":"3.37.3"},"reference-count":27,"publisher":"Institute of Electrical and Electronics Engineers (IEEE)","issue":"10","license":[{"start":{"date-parts":[[2017,10,1]],"date-time":"2017-10-01T00:00:00Z","timestamp":1506816000000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/ieeexplore.ieee.org\/Xplorehelp\/downloads\/license-information\/IEEE.html"},{"start":{"date-parts":[[2017,10,1]],"date-time":"2017-10-01T00:00:00Z","timestamp":1506816000000},"content-version":"am","delay-in-days":0,"URL":"https:\/\/ieeexplore.ieee.org\/Xplorehelp\/downloads\/license-information\/IEEE.html"},{"start":{"date-parts":[[2017,10,1]],"date-time":"2017-10-01T00:00:00Z","timestamp":1506816000000},"content-version":"stm-asf","delay-in-days":0,"URL":"https:\/\/doi.org\/10.15223\/policy-029"},{"start":{"date-parts":[[2017,10,1]],"date-time":"2017-10-01T00:00:00Z","timestamp":1506816000000},"content-version":"stm-asf","delay-in-days":0,"URL":"https:\/\/doi.org\/10.15223\/policy-037"}],"funder":[{"DOI":"10.13039\/100000001","name":"National Science Foundation","doi-asserted-by":"publisher","award":["1314598"],"award-info":[{"award-number":["1314598"]}],"id":[{"id":"10.13039\/100000001","id-type":"DOI","asserted-by":"publisher"}]}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":["IEEE Trans. Comput."],"published-print":{"date-parts":[[2017,10,1]]},"DOI":"10.1109\/tc.2017.2700795","type":"journal-article","created":{"date-parts":[[2017,5,3]],"date-time":"2017-05-03T18:14:33Z","timestamp":1493835273000},"page":"1778-1789","source":"Crossref","is-referenced-by-count":9,"title":["Vector Instruction Set Extensions for Efficient Computation of &lt;sc&gt;Keccak&lt;\/sc&gt;"],"prefix":"10.1109","volume":"66","author":[{"given":"Hemendra","family":"Rawat","sequence":"first","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Patrick","family":"Schaumont","sequence":"additional","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"263","reference":[{"key":"ref10","doi-asserted-by":"crossref","first-page":"1","DOI":"10.1145\/2024716.2024718","article-title":"The GEM5 simulator","volume":"39","author":"binkert","year":"2011","journal-title":"SIGARCH Comput Archit News"},{"key":"ref11","doi-asserted-by":"publisher","DOI":"10.1145\/2948618.2948622"},{"key":"ref12","doi-asserted-by":"crossref","first-page":"930","DOI":"10.1109\/JSSC.2016.2519386","article-title":"A RISC-V vector processor with simultaneous-switching switched-capacitor DC-DC converters in 28 nm FDSOI","volume":"51","author":"zimmer","year":"2016","journal-title":"J Solid-State Circuits"},{"article-title":"KECCAK implementation overview","year":"2012","author":"bertoni","key":"ref13"},{"key":"ref14","doi-asserted-by":"crossref","first-page":"51","DOI":"10.1145\/2666141.2666144","article-title":"Simple AEAD hardware interface (S&#x00C6;HI) in a SoC: Implementing an on-chip keyak\/whirlbob coprocessor","author":"saarinen","year":"2014","journal-title":"Proc 4th Int Workshop Trustworthy Embedded Devices TrustED &#x2019;14 Scottsdale Arizona USA"},{"key":"ref15","doi-asserted-by":"publisher","DOI":"10.1109\/ReConFig.2015.7393283"},{"article-title":"Investigating the Potential of Custom Instruction Set Extensions for SHA-3 Candidates on a 16-bit Microcontroller Architecture","year":"2012","author":"constantin","key":"ref16"},{"key":"ref17","doi-asserted-by":"publisher","DOI":"10.1109\/EDSSC.2015.7285111"},{"article-title":"Method and apparatus to process keccak secure hashing algorithm","year":"2013","author":"yap","key":"ref18"},{"article-title":"The Keccak Code Package","year":"2016","author":"bertoni","key":"ref19"},{"key":"ref4","doi-asserted-by":"publisher","DOI":"10.1109\/VLSID.2006.131"},{"journal-title":"SAMSUNG Corporation","article-title":"Samsung Foundry 32\/28nm Low-Power High-K Metal Gate Logic Process and Design Ecosystem","year":"2011","key":"ref27"},{"journal-title":"Duplexing the Sponge Single-Pass Authenticated Encryption and Other Applications","year":"2012","author":"bertoni","key":"ref3"},{"article-title":"Intel SHA Extensions &#x2013; New Instructions Supporting the Secure Hash Algorithm on Intel Architecture Processor","year":"2013","author":"gulley","key":"ref6"},{"article-title":"Intel Advanced Encryption Standard (AES) New Instruction Set","year":"2010","author":"gueron","key":"ref5"},{"article-title":"CAESAR submission: Keyak v2","year":"2015","author":"bertoni","key":"ref8"},{"article-title":"Intel Carry-less Multiplication Instruction and its Usage for Computing the GCM Model","year":"2014","author":"gueron","key":"ref7"},{"key":"ref2","first-page":"33","article-title":"Sponge-based pseudo-random number generators","author":"bertoni","year":"2010","journal-title":"Proc Int Workshop Cryptographic Hardware Embedded Syst"},{"article-title":"CAESAR submission: Ketje v2","year":"2014","author":"bertoni","key":"ref9"},{"key":"ref1","article-title":"Sponge functions","author":"bertoni","year":"2007","journal-title":"Ecrypt Hash Workshop"},{"key":"ref20","doi-asserted-by":"publisher","DOI":"10.6028\/NIST.FIPS.202"},{"article-title":"The Keccak reference","year":"2011","author":"bertoni","key":"ref22"},{"key":"ref21","article-title":"KangarooTwelve: Fast Hashing based on Keccak-p","author":"bertoni","year":"2016","journal-title":"Cryptology ePrint Archive Report"},{"article-title":"1001 Ways to Implement Keccak","year":"2012","author":"bertoni","key":"ref24"},{"key":"ref23","doi-asserted-by":"publisher","DOI":"10.1109\/SASP.2008.4570780"},{"key":"ref26","doi-asserted-by":"publisher","DOI":"10.1109\/ISOCC.2013.6864006"},{"key":"ref25","doi-asserted-by":"publisher","DOI":"10.1109\/ReConFig.2011.16"}],"container-title":["IEEE Transactions on Computers"],"original-title":[],"link":[{"URL":"http:\/\/ieeexplore.ieee.org\/ielaam\/12\/8026540\/7918507-aam.pdf","content-type":"application\/pdf","content-version":"am","intended-application":"syndication"},{"URL":"http:\/\/xplorestaging.ieee.org\/ielx7\/12\/8026540\/07918507.pdf?arnumber=7918507","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2022,7,28]],"date-time":"2022-07-28T05:40:33Z","timestamp":1658986833000},"score":1,"resource":{"primary":{"URL":"http:\/\/ieeexplore.ieee.org\/document\/7918507\/"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2017,10,1]]},"references-count":27,"journal-issue":{"issue":"10"},"URL":"https:\/\/doi.org\/10.1109\/tc.2017.2700795","relation":{},"ISSN":["0018-9340"],"issn-type":[{"type":"print","value":"0018-9340"}],"subject":[],"published":{"date-parts":[[2017,10,1]]}}}